This testimonial will focus on evidence for the application of the very first three approaches when spaces are occupied. Of these techniques, upper-room UVGI has actually been made use of for greater than 70 years to minimize transmission of pathogens such as tuberculosis (TB). The research studies in this review cover different UVGI innovations that can be made use of in rooms with people existing, including UV-C lamps that are wall-mounted, UV-C ceiling fans, and portable UV-C air cleansers.
9 studies were included, nine coverage on the performance (See Evidence Table 1-3) and two reporting on the safety and security (Table 4) of UVGI technologies to minimize SARS-CoV-2 in the air of busy spaces. The proof was from simulation (n=8) and empirical (n=1) studies and overall the degree of evidence in this review is taken into consideration reduced.
Both the wall surface placed and ceiling follower components have sanitizing UV-C lamps that aim up at the ceiling. These modern technologies worked in minimizing SARS-CoV-2 airborne of occupied rooms in both observational (n=1) and simulation (n=6) studies. A Russian hospital reported only neighborhood acquired COVID-19 situations amongst team April to June 2020 and no transmission amongst patients to team in healthcare facility rooms with wall-mounted upper space UVGI components (low-pressure mercury lamps, 254 nm).

This included a field examination and a simulation research. High level points are listed here and details on private studies can be found in Table 4. An area investigation from Russia reported that top area UVGI low-pressure mercury lamps (254 nm, 30 W) made use of 24 hr a day, 7 days a week, in busy health center rooms were safe.
The greater the UVGI light lies on the wall, the lower the threat of over-exposure. If the ceiling elevation is 2.74 m, a UVGI lamp installing height of 2.29 m causes a decreased degree of UV-C radiation reflected right into the reduced area of the space, contrasted to a mounting height of 2.13 m.
When both UVGI lamps were found on one lengthy wall surface of the room, it led to the least expensive danger of too much exposure.
